Typical Oakton Dedicated Circuit Installation Scenarios

A few typical Oakton dedicated circuit scenarios:

Hunter Mill Estates EV charger plus battery backup integration

A 1972 Hunter Mill Estates wooded-lot home adding a Tesla Wall Connector and integrating with EcoFlow battery backup. Scope: 100-amp to 200-amp main panel upgrade with Span Smart Panel installation, EcoFlow battery system, 40-amp dedicated EV charger circuit, well pump configured as priority backup circuit, and network equipment on backup. Total scope: $14,500-$22,500.

Trotters Glen hot tub installation with FPE replacement

A 1978 Trotters Glen single-family home is installing a hot tub on the rear deck. Bundled with the replacement of the home's original Federal Pacific Stab-Lok panel. Scope: FPE replacement plus 100-amp to 200-amp service upgrade, 50-amp 240V GFCI-protected hot tub circuit, disconnect switch within sight, hot tub equipment bonding per code, exterior conduit run. Total scope: $5,500-$8,000.

Hunter Mill Road area detached workshop subpanel

A 1975 Hunter Mill Road area home adding a detached workshop building with substantial electrical needs (table saw, planer, dust collection, air compressor). Scope: 100-amp subpanel installation in the detached workshop fed from the main house panel through underground conduit, branch circuits for workshop equipment (some 240V), workshop lighting, weatherproof outdoor outlets, and a sub-panel grounding electrode at the workshop. Total scope: $4,500-$7,500.

Oakton primary bathroom heated towel bar plus sauna

An Oakton primary bathroom renovation adding a heated towel bar and electric sauna. Scope: 20-amp dedicated heated towel bar circuit, 30-amp 240V dedicated sauna circuit, GFCI per bathroom code, coordinated with the bathroom renovation timing. Total scope: $1,500-$2,200.

Wooded-Lot, Storm Exposure & Battery Backup Coordination in Oakton

Oakton's wooded-lot housing pattern and mature tree canopy give the area a distinctive electrical profile. The most relevant operational reality is storm exposure — Oakton experiences meaningfully more storm-caused outages than more open suburban communities, both from direct lightning effects on the distribution lines serving the wooded neighborhoods and from tree-fall events that bring lines down. 12-72-hour outages happen multiple times per year in some Oakton neighborhoods.

Battery backup and generator coordination is a near-universal Oakton scope. Most Oakton electrical projects of any meaningful size coordinate with one of: generator inlet with interlock kit (for portable generator backup), permanent standby generator with automatic transfer switch, EcoFlow Delta Pro Ultra battery backup, Tesla Powerwall, FranklinWH, or Span Smart Panel with battery backup integration. Critical-load subpanels feeding the most important household circuits (well pump if applicable, refrigerator, primary bedroom, internet/networking, one HVAC zone, freeze-protection circuits) are standard architecture.

Many Oakton homes run on well water rather than municipal water, which makes well pump backup a quality-of-life requirement during extended outages. The well pump is typically the highest-priority load on the critical-load subpanel. Freeze-protection circuits for outdoor pipes and well pump houses are also standard scope in Oakton, given the winter outage exposure.

Whole-home surge protection has elevated importance in Oakton, given the lightning exposure — premium Type 2 SPDs with higher kA per phase ratings are the default for Oakton homes.\

Outdoor kitchen dedicated circuits include a built-in grill (50-amp 240V if electric), an outdoor refrigerator (20-amp), outdoor counter outlets with GFCI in-use covers, and outdoor lighting on a dedicated transformer circuit. Some outdoor kitchens also include warming drawers, ice makers, or beverage fridges — each on dedicated circuits. Scope: $3,500-$6,500.

Yes — with battery backup hardware and a Span Smart Panel. The well pump is configured as a priority backup circuit; during a grid outage, the EcoFlow battery powers the well pump (and other essentials) while non-essential loads shed automatically. Battery sizing determines how long sustained well pump operation continues — typically 24-72 hours on a 15-25 kWh system, depending on usage patterns.
